Introduction to YouTube SEO

YouTube SEO is the process of optimizing your videos to rank higher in YouTube's search results, increasing your visibility, and driving more views, engagement, and conversions. According to a study by HubSpot, 70% of B2B buyers watch videos throughout the buyer's journey, making YouTube an ideal platform for B2B marketers to reach their target audience. Research shows that YouTube videos can increase brand awareness by up to 30% and drive a 20% increase in sales (Source: Google).

The Benefits of YouTube SEO for B2B Marketing

The benefits of YouTube SEO for B2B marketing are numerous. For one, YouTube videos can increase the average time spent on a website by up to 2 minutes, which can lead to higher engagement and conversion rates. Additionally, YouTube videos can be used to establish thought leadership, build trust, and educate customers about complex products or services. According to a study by Forbes, 75% of executives watch work-related videos on business websites at least once a week, making YouTube an ideal platform for B2B marketers to reach their target audience.
